Dentist Salary Pay: Rancho Cucamonga vs State & National Average
| Category | Rancho Cucamonga | California Avg | National Avg |
|---|---|---|---|
| Average salary | $205,290 | $193,503 | $180,000 |
| Low estimate | $148,265 | $145,127 | $135,000 |
| High estimate | $262,315 | $251,554 | $234,000 |

Dentist Salary by Career Stage in Rancho Cucamonga
Early Career (0-3 years)
$126,025 – $184,761/yearEntry-level dentist in Rancho Cucamonga
Focus on skill development over salary optimization. Consider negotiating remote flexibility to offset high living costs.
Mid-Career (4-8 years)
$195,026 – $236,084/yearExperienced dentist with specialized skills
This is your highest-leverage negotiation window. Multiple offers and demonstrated impact justify 15-25% above market midpoint in Rancho Cucamonga.
Senior (8+ years)
$225,819 – $301,662/yearSenior dentist or team lead
At this level, base salary matters less than total compensation. Equity, bonuses, and leadership opportunities in Rancho Cucamonga's market can add 30-50% to your effective pay.
